Бесплатный урок с нашим репетитором!

Узнать подробнее

Новая Школа - онлайн-школа подготовки к ЕГЭ
При поддержке
Посмотреть все вопросы нейросети
Бесплатный пробный урок с репетитором

Узнай больше про репетиторов Новой Школы и запишись на бесплатный пробный урок. Мы проверим твой уровень знаний и составим план обучения по любому предмету и классу

Вопрос от Анонимного юзера 23 декабря 2024 02:02

ВОПРОСЫ И ЗАДАНИЯ Напишите программу вычисления наименьшего общего кратного следующих четырёх чисел: 36, 54, 18 и 15. Используйте процедуру вычисления наибольшего общего делителя двух чисел. ab Подсказка: НОК(a, b) = НОД(а, в) Python

Ответ нейросети

23 декабря 2024 02:02

Для нахождения наименьшего общего кратного (НОК) четырех чисел, можно использовать формулу, основанную на вычислении наибольшего общего делителя (НОД). Формула выглядит следующим образом:

[ \text{НОК}(a, b) = \frac{|a \cdot b|}{\text{НОД}(a, b)} ]

Для нескольких чисел НОК можно вычислить поэтапно, используя два числа за раз.

Давайте сначала создадим функцию для вычисления НОД, а затем с её помощью мы вычислим НОК для заданных чисел 36, 54, 18 и 15.

Вот пример программы на Python:

def gcd(a, b):
    while b:
        a, b = b, a % b
    return a

def lcm(a, b):
    return abs(a * b) // gcd(a, b)

# Даны числа
numbers = [36, 54, 18, 15]

# Вычисление НОК для всех чисел
result_lcm = numbers[0]
for num in numbers[1:]:
    result_lcm = lcm(result_lcm, num)

print(f"Наименьшее общее кратное чисел {numbers} равно {result_lcm}.")

Объяснение:

  1. Функция gcd вычисляет наибольший общий делитель двух чисел с использованием алгоритма Евклида.
  2. Функция lcm использует gcd для расчёта наименьшего общего кратного двух чисел по формуле.
  3. Мы начинаем с первого числа в списке и затем итеративно вычисляем НОК с последующими числами.
  4. В итоге мы выводим результат.

Запустив эту программу, вы получите наименьшее общее кратное для чисел 36, 54, 18 и 15. Если у вас есть дополнительные вопросы или вам нужно пояснение по конкретным частям кода, не стесняйтесь спрашивать!

Задай свой вопрос

Напиши любую задачу или вопрос, а нейросеть её решит

Похожие вопросы 15

Бесплатно Мобильное приложение ГДЗ
Мобильное приложение ГДЗ

Задавай вопросы искуcственному интеллекту текстом или фотографиями в приложении на iPhone или Android

qr-codegoogle-playapp-store

Саша — ассистент в телеграмме

ВОПРОСЫ И ЗАДАНИЯ Напишите программу вычисления наименьшего общего кратного следующих четырёх чисел: 36, 54, 18 и 15. Используйте процедуру вычисления наибольшего общего делителя двух чисел. ab Подсказка: НОК(a, b) = НОД(а, в) Python
Для нахождения наименьшего общего кратного (НОК) четырех чисел, можно использовать формулу, основанную на вычислении наибольшего общего делителя (НОД). Формула выглядит следующим образом: \[ \text{НОК}(a, b) = \frac{|a \cdot b|}{\text{НОД}(a, b)} \] Для нескольких чисел НОК можно вычислить поэтапно, используя два числа за раз. Давайте сначала создадим функцию для вычисления НОД, а затем с её помощью мы вычислим НОК для заданных чисел 36, 54, 18 и 15. Вот пример программы на Python: ```python def gcd(a, b): while b: a, b = b, a % b return a def lcm(a, b): return abs(a * b) // gcd(a, b) # Даны числа numbers = [36, 54, 18, 15] # Вычисление НОК для всех чисел result_lcm = numbers[0] for num in numbers[1:]: result_lcm = lcm(result_lcm, num) print(f"Наименьшее общее кратное чисел {numbers} равно {result_lcm}.") ``` ### Объяснение: 1. Функция `gcd` вычисляет наибольший общий делитель двух чисел с использованием алгоритма Евклида. 2. Функция `lcm` использует `gcd` для расчёта наименьшего общего кратного двух чисел по формуле. 3. Мы начинаем с первого числа в списке и затем итеративно вычисляем НОК с последующими числами. 4. В итоге мы выводим результат. Запустив эту программу, вы получите наименьшее общее кратное для чисел 36, 54, 18 и 15. Если у вас есть дополнительные вопросы или вам нужно пояснение по конкретным частям кода, не стесняйтесь спрашивать!